1、M2 U4 Wildlife Protection教學(xué)目標(biāo):知識與技能:a. Be able to understand and use the words and expressions in this passage幫助同學(xué)們理解并掌握一些單詞和短語b.Students will know some basic information about the endangered animals讓同學(xué)們了解一些關(guān)于瀕臨滅絕的動物基本信息過程與方法:a. students will develop their abilities of thinking and expressing their
2、attitude towards the wildlife and the wildlife protection.鼓勵同學(xué)們思考并表達(dá)他們關(guān)于野生動植物及其保護(hù)的態(tài)度b.students reading ability will be enhanced and students ability and skills of guessing words and reading comprehension will be developed.提高學(xué)生們的閱讀理解能力,并發(fā)展其猜詞的能力和技巧情感態(tài)度與價(jià)值觀:a. Through reading this text, students will
3、understand the importance of the wildlife protection and be more active in helping wildlife.通過閱讀本文,學(xué)生能夠理解保護(hù)野生動植物的重要性,并更積極參與幫助野生動植物的活動b. Through the teaching activities, students will develop their sense of cooperative learning.通過一系列的課堂活動培養(yǎng)學(xué)生們合作學(xué)習(xí)的意識教學(xué)重難點(diǎn):Key points: ss can discover the different liv
4、ing situations of different wildlife in Daisys journey.教學(xué)重點(diǎn):理解Daisy 在神奇之旅中發(fā)現(xiàn)不同野生動物的不同生存狀況Difficult points: ss can sense the change of Daisys emotions during her journey.教學(xué)難點(diǎn):體會Daisy 在神奇之旅中的情感變化教學(xué)方法:Communicative teaching method, Task-based language teaching method, direct method教學(xué)過程1:Leading inShow
